Re: wtb 90 ZR1 Thermostat housing
I have a couple of used ones, one of whiich has a broken off hearter hose adapter. A common problem, easily fixed. Just haven't had time to get it to a machine shop to have the broken part (dutchman) removed and threads chased. The other one is still intact with the pot-metal adapter. It really needs to be removed also & have a steel one installed.
